His side of the story


Victim of Marriage 2

When I was a bachelor
She was my best choice
A loving
Caring spinster of honour
And virtue
A second away from her
Was like eternity
A minute with her
Can not be described
I enjoyed every moment of our courtship

But when we became one
And had our first child
We had our first test
I lost my job
My wife became a terror
A viper of the first order
No more food
No more hug
No more Kisses

I became her bitter heart
The pepper in her eyes
The father of her child
And the victim of marriage

Now it's her turn
To feel the pain
And fill the blank space I left
The Victim of Marriage




Poetry by Okuola Paul Abiola
